Abstract

The invention relates to a large-scale thrust bearing turnover device which comprises a hoisting ring and a rolling ring; the hoisting ring and the rolling ring are symmetrically fixed at the two axial ends of a large-scale thrust bearing turnover device in a sleeving manner respectively; a main lifting lug is fixedly mounted on the outer side of the hoisting ring; an auxiliary lifting hug I is fixedly mounted on the inner side of the hoisting ring; an auxiliary lifting lug II is fixedly mounted on the inner side of the rolling ring. The large-scale thrust bearing turnover device is simple in structure, convenient and easy to operate, and light and handy in turnover, and has a turnover tooling; the turnover tooling has a universal process, is simpler, safer, low in cost, high in efficiency and easy to operate, and can be combined with a clamping tooling, so that the disassembling requirements are reduced, the operation difficulty is lowered, and the efficiency and the universality are improved.

Background technology
Hydrogenerator is applied in the place away from city more, usual needs power to the load through comparatively long power transmission line, therefore, the operation stability of electric system to hydrogenerator proposes higher requirement, and the build guality for each parts of water turbine requires there is strict demand.For super-huge water turbine lower bearing bracket due to volume excessive, its production difficulty can obviously increase.
The manufacture difficult point of thrust baring except very high planeness, parallelism, and outside roughness requirements.This workpiece needs constantly to stand up in whole manufacturing process, and overturns each time and all may produce harmful effect to high-precision finished surface.In production in the past, the upset of thrust baring is the use of thrust baring transport frock, and every platform product is all corresponding installs a transport frock, this transport frock is a casing loaded by Total Product, fixing rear box carries out integrated overturn together with product, very complicated during operation, product needed custom-made transport frock of each specification corresponding, with high costs, and vanning, fixing, upset, the work such as to devan is very loaded down with trivial details, consuming time.

Detailed description of the invention
Below in conjunction with accompanying drawing, also by specific embodiment, the invention will be further described, and following examples are descriptive, are not determinate, can not limit protection scope of the present invention with this.
A kind of Large-scale Thrust Bearings turning device, comprise one and hang circle 2 and a rolling ring 5, shown in accompanying drawing 1, hang circle and rolling ring is symmetrical is respectively set with the radial two ends being fixed on Large-scale Thrust Bearings 1, hang circle outside and be fixed with a main hanger 3, hang circle inner side and be fixed with an auxiliary hanger 4; An auxiliary hanger is fixed with inside rolling ring.
When needing upset thrust baring, the lanyard of crane connects main hanger and is mentioned by thrust baring, and opposite side rolling ring in ground surface, does not need to leave ground in switching process, convenient and safety; Auxiliary hanger connects lifting rope, auxiliary control reverses direction.
The agent structure of hanging circle and rolling ring is formed by two semicircular ring relatively fastened, and shown in accompanying drawing 2, the connection location at semicircular ring two ends is all shaped with the connecting panel 6 of an inside bending, relatively affixed by bolt, is convenient to connect, and is beneficial to rotation;
Inside semicircular ring, be shaped with the fixture block 7 closing keyboard with thrust baring and coordinate, effectively prevent from jumping in rotation process, filling flexible propping material in semicircular ring, can available protecting precision face, and the adjusting mechanism of flexibility, frock commonality can be guaranteed.
